Open the Preference pane, right-click on Magic Prefs and select ‘Remove MagicPrefs Preference Pane.’ Do the same for the Magic Menu item in the Preferences pane. I believe I gave you that work flow before and you tested that. Drag MagicPrefs.app (found in your Applications folder) to the trash.
